Seniors Club Chips In for Community Center

The Anaheim Senior Citizens Club has donated $50,000 to help pay for furnishings and equipment at the Downtown Community Center, under construction next to City Hall.

A fund-raising effort, led by the Anaheim Community Foundation, is underway to pay for interior improvements for the center, planned for completion next May. More than $500,000 has already been raised, city officials said.

The $8.5-million facility will include a senior citizens center, the city’s first public gymnasium, a boxing club, conference and meeting rooms and human services offices.
